Should I Hire Wedding Vendors in a Specific Order?

We get asked by so many couples during the wedding planning process, Should I Hire Wedding Vendors in a Specific Order? There are some wedding vendors that we highly recommend hiring before others to ensure your wedding day is all that you dreamed it would be. When it comes to wedding planning, it's all about prioritizing and timing. We've compiled a timeline that we think is best to hire a specific wedding vendor.

Should I Hire Wedding Vendors in a Specific Order? - Photographer: Onsite Photography LLC


1. Wedding Planner


One of the best things you can do when planning your wedding is to hire a wedding planner. We recommend hiring a wedding planner at least 12 months before your wedding date. Wedding planners can assist you with establishing a realistic budget, finding a venue and securing other vendors. Your wedding planner will be there from start to finish offering guidance throughout the entire planning process. Of course, you can still do things on your own such as researching venues and other vendors that are recommended. However, we wouldn't recommend booking a venue or any vendors without consulting your wedding planner who can assist with contracts, tours and so much more. If hiring a wedding planner isn't in your budget, we recommend hiring a wedding coordinator to assist with your planning. Many wedding coordinators begin working with you at least 2-3 months before your wedding date.



2. Venue


Next on our timeline of "Should I Hire Wedding Vendors in a Specific Order? booking a venue. Just like finding a wedding planner, we recommend booking a wedding venue at least 12 months in advance. Since the pandemic, we would even recommend booking a wedding venue 18 to 24 months in advance. Many venues are playing "catch up" from weddings that were postponed and rescheduled.



3. Band or DJ


Whether you plan on having a band or DJ, we recommend booking this type of vendor at least 11 months in advance. If you have your heart set on a particular band or DJ, you may want to reach out to them even sooner. You would want to provide entertainment at your wedding. Many vendors are also booked up due to the pandemic and weddings being rescheduled or postponed.



4. Photographer


Your wedding day wouldn't be the same without a professional photographer. You don't want to miss those cherished and priceless moments being caught on camera. We recommend hiring a photographer at least 11 months during your wedding planning process. Again, if there is a specific photographer that you absolutely must have at your wedding check their availability a whole lot sooner.



5. Makeup Artists and Hair Stylist


If you are planning on having your hair and makeup done professionally, we recommend booking them at least 8 to 9 months in advance. MUAs and hair stylists that specialize in weddings may require booking in advance especially during peak season.
